How Isaiah 23:2 Stood Out

This page may have some technical imperfections, but is made available before inspection for you to benefit from the majority of material that likely has no problems.


Isaiah 23:2 (2024) – Be still, ye inhabitants of the isle; thou whom the merchants of Zidon, that pass over the sea, have replenished. [cf. Ps. 4:4 – Stand in awe, and sin not: commune with your own heart upon your bed, and be still. Selah. Ps. 46:10 – Be still, and know that I am God: I will be exalted among the heathen, I will be exalted in the earth. Job 37:14 – Hearken unto this, O Job: stand still, and consider the wondrous works of God.]
